
服务器实例的地域更换是一个涉及多个技术层面和管理决策的过程,在云计算环境中,服务器实例通常指的是虚拟机或者物理服务器,它们运行在数据中心内,为用户提供计算资源,由于业务需求的变化、成本考虑、法律法规要求或是为了提高访问速度和服务质量,用户可能需要将服务器实例迁移到不同的地理位置。
以下是关于服务器实例更换地域的一些关键点:
1、 可行性 :大多数云服务提供商都支持跨区域迁移服务,但这个过程可能涉及到停机时间,因此需要仔细规划。
2、 成本 :更换地域可能会产生额外的费用,包括但不限于数据传输费、迁移服务费以及新地域的资源费用。
3、 数据一致性 :在迁移过程中,确保数据的一致性和完整性是至关重要的,这可能需要使用快照、备份或其他同步机制。
4、 网络延迟 :更换地域后,用户的访问延迟可能会有所变化,这需要提前评估和测试。
5、 法律法规遵守 :不同地区有不同的数据保护法律和规定,迁移前需要确保符合目标地域的法律要求。
6、 技术支持 :在迁移过程中,可能需要云服务提供商的技术支持,以确保迁移的顺利进行。
7、 性能监控 :迁移完成后,需要对服务器实例的性能进行监控,以确保它达到了预期的工作状态。
8、 回滚计划 :在任何重大变更中,都应该有一个回滚计划,以便于在出现问题时能够恢复到原始状态。
9、 用户通知 :如果服务器实例的地域更换会影响到用户,那么应该提前通知用户,并解释可能的影响和应对措施。
10、 文档记录 :整个迁移过程应该有详细的文档记录,以便于未来的参考和审计。
下面是一个简化的表格,了更换服务器实例地域的主要步骤:
步骤 描述 1. 评估 确定迁移的必要性和预期目标。 2. 规划 制定详细的迁移计划,包括时间表和资源分配。 3. 备份 创建服务器实例的数据备份,以防迁移过程中出现数据丢失。 4. 通知 向所有相关方发送迁移通知,包括用户和内部团队。 5. 执行 按照计划执行迁移操作,包括数据迁移和配置更新。 6. 验证 在迁移后验证服务器实例的功能和性能是否符合预期。 7. 监控 持续监控服务器实例的性能,并处理可能出现的问题。 8. 文档 记录迁移过程和结果,为未来提供参考。FAQs:
Q1: 更换服务器实例地域会影响IP地址吗?
A1: 是的,更换地域通常会导致服务器实例的公网IP地址发生变化,因为IP地址是与地理位置相关的,在迁移过程中,需要更新DNS记录和任何依赖于特定IP地址的服务配置。
Q2: 如何最小化更换服务器实例地域时的停机时间?
A2: 为了最小化停机时间,可以采取以下措施:
使用负载均衡器在迁移过程中分发流量。

安排在低峰时段进行迁移。
使用预热(warm-up)策略,即在新地域预先启动服务器实例并进行必要的配置。
如果可能,使用无停机迁移技术,如在线迁移或热迁移。
小编有话说:
更换服务器实例的地域是一个复杂的过程,但它也可能是提升服务质量、满足法规要求或降低成本的关键步骤,在进行这样的变更时,重要的是要有一个周密的计划,考虑到所有潜在的风险和影响,并与所有相关方进行充分的沟通,无论迁移多么复杂,最终的目标都是为了提供更好的用户体验和服务。
在服务器上能看到你登录的网站,但能看到你写的内容么?
理论上可以 要看他需要不需要那个功能
电信的无线网卡连接不上?提示说远程计算机没有响应!该怎么解决?
是电信的问题,打电话给电信,主要得看那个错误代码是什么。那句话不重要..
怎么查看本机已经安装的sqlserver的所有实例名
展开全部您好,很高兴能帮助您,来源于csdn一、查看实例名时可用1、服务—SQL Server(实例名),默认实例为(MSSQLSERVER)或在连接企业管理时-查看本地实例2、通过注册表HKEY_LOCAL_MACHINE/SOFTWARE/Microsoft/Microsoft SQL Server/InstalledInstance3、用命令sqlcmd/osqlsqlcmd -Lsqlcmd -Lcosql -L获取可用实例,以下举一个例子,根据自己情况改DECLARE @Table TABLE ( instanceNamesysname NULL)insert @Table EXEC _cmdshell sqlcmd -Lc--LEFT(@@serverName,CHARINDEX(/,@@serverName+/)-1) 替代为本机名就行了 , 根据实例命名规则判断SELECT * FROM @Table WHERE instanceName LIKE LEFT( @@serverName , CHARINDEX ( / , @@serverName + / )- 1)+ %二、 SERVERPROPERTY(InstanceName)--2sp_helpserver--3select @@SERVERNAME--4SELECT * FROM --5SELECT * FROM 三、EXECUTE xp_regread @rootkey=HKEY_LOCAL_MACHINE,@key=SOFTWARE/Microsoft/Microsoft SQL Server/Instance Names/SQl,@value_name=MSSQLSERVER四、Select CaseWhen SERVERPROPERTY (InstanceName) Is Null Then @@SERVERNAMEElse SERVERPROPERTY (InstanceName)End五、在本地或网络得到所有实例名1、You can do with registry reading , like my codeusing System;using 32;namespace SMOTest{class Program{static void Main(){RegistryKey rk = (@SOFTWARE/Microsoft/Microsoft SQL Server);String[] instances = (String[])(InstalledInstances);if ( > 0){ foreach (String element in instances) {if (element == MSSQLSERVER) ();else ( + @/ + element); }}}}}2、You can use to retrieve the list of SQL Server can be found from the C:/Program Files/Microsoft SQL Server/80/Tools/Bin folder. Refer this assembly in your project and the following snippet would return a List Object containing the sql server static List GetSQLServerInstances() {NameList sqlNameList = null;Application app = null;var sqlServers = new List();try {app = new ApplicationClass();sqlNameList = ();foreach (string sqlServer in sqlNameList)(sqlServer);}catch(Exception ex){//play with the exception.} finally {if (sqlNameList != null)sqlNameList = null;if (app != null)app = null;}return sqlServers;}你的采纳是我前进的动力,还有不懂的地方,请你继续“追问”!如你还有别的问题,可另外向我求助;答题不易,互相理解,互相帮助!
发表评论